While it is the goal of the project photographer Bonnie Fournier to collect heart-lifting images from around the world, the happy reality is that there are far more affectionate people in the world than she could ever hope to personally photograph. In an effort to be inclusive, extending an open invitation to anyone interested in submitting their smoochy photographs to the Smooch! Contributors’ Gallery was the best solution to this challenge.
Files with extensions gif, jpg, jpeg, jpe, png, eps, tif, or tiff are accepted. Please submit the largest file (highest resolution) possible, up to 5 MB.
All submissions must include a “smooch,” preferably in similar poses as commonly seen in photos within The Smooch! Project Archive. Other demonstrations of affection, such as hugs, pats on the head, etc., while loving and appealing in their own right, are not a good visual or thematic fit for The Smooch! Project. Photographs of adults kissing lip-to-lip will also not be included within the Smooch! Contributors gallery. (See below for more on this guideline.) Smooch “Sandwiches” (i.e., more than 2 people) are welcome here. Please visit our gallery for examples of the kind of images we are looking for.
Everyone has their own personal definition of love and affection. The guidelines for contributed photos to this gallery are based on the personal definition of the project photographer. From her viewpoint, The Smooch! Project is about AFFECTION. Photographs of two adults kissing lip-to-lip always include a sexual undertone, however subtle. Sex is an extremely powerful human drive. Even the slightest hint of it within a photograph can easily overpower the obvious display of affection that Fournier aims for in every photograph within the Smooch! Project website. For this reason, the photographer has decided that lip-to-lip images will not be included within the Smooch! galleries.
